I’m a senior account executive with what I believe is the best public relations firm in the CEDIA channel, Caster Communications, based in Wakefield, Rhode Island. I’m the lead PR representative for Universal Remote Control, NuVo Technologies and Sooloos. Caster also represents Life|ware, Planar, Runco, Vidikron, Paradigm, Anthem, Microsoft WIndows Media Center, Richard Gray’s Power Company, Screen Research and SE2 Labs.

I embarked on my new career as a PR person with Caster last August, after a 16-year career as a tech journalist. I’ve been working in the CEDIA channel since 2002. From 2005 to 2007, I was the editor-in-chief of CustomRetailer magazine, one of CE Pro‘s competitors.
